angularjs-filter相关内容
在我的项目中,我尝试将过滤器与显示在表格和地图上的 geojson 同步.为了实现这一点,我使用了 angular 和以前的 angular-leaflet-directive,但是出于我的目的,性能会变慢,所以我决定为 leaflet.js 制作自己的指令. 在我的情况下,我可以将数据从控制器传递到我的指令,但它使地图成为静态,当我尝试在过滤后传递数据以使我的地图动态时,地图没有显示任何标
..
我有一个带有过滤器的 ng-repeat.当某些项目被过滤器过滤掉,然后在另一个过滤器更改后恢复时,就会为这些项目创建新的 DOM 元素.如果对项目进行了任何 DOM 操作,它会在项目被过滤器隐藏和恢复后丢失. 有没有办法保留 DOM 元素,即使项目被过滤器移除? 我尝试使用 track by,但没有用. 这是一个重现问题的 fiddle.重新创建的步骤: 单击按钮将颜色应
..
我的项目要求以货币格式显示金额字段.我可以实现这个 onblur 事件,但请告诉我是否可以使用过滤器或其他一些 AngularJS 技术来实现. 我有以下文本框: 我想将此文本框中的值转换为遵循货币格式.所以,如果我输入 200000,它应该是 $200,000.00 在我输入时或在我输入时. 我使用了以下技术并应用了过滤器,
..
看到了一些通过复选框过滤数据的选项,但对于我希望 Angular 轻松完成的事情来说,这一切似乎都过于复杂. 了解一下 http://plnkr.co/edit/Gog4qkLKxeH7x3EnBT0i 这里有一些过滤器,但我感兴趣的是复选框.使用一个非常漂亮的 Angular UI 模块,我发现它叫做 Unique,它列出了不同类型的提供者,而不是重复它们,只列出每种类型中的一个.可
..
是否可以过滤一个对象数组,使得属性的值可以是几个值中的一个(OR 条件)而无需编写自定义过滤器 这类似于这个问题——Angular.js ng-repeat:按单个字段过滤 但不是 是否可以做这样的事情
示例数据如下- $sco
..
我正在尝试制作一个过滤器,为过滤器传递多个值,但只有一个返回值. field: 'name',筛选: {条件:函数(searchTerm,cellValue){var strippedValue = (searchTerm).split(';');//console.log(strippedValue);for (i = 0; i
..
我的 ng-view 中有一个 10(或 n)复选框.现在我想问这里检查复选框是否被选中以及如果选中获取复选框的值的最有效或最简单的方法是什么. 我有 ng-controller(getAlbu
..
我是 AngularJS 的新手,正在尝试创建一个简单的应用程序,它允许我将文件上传到我的 Laravel 驱动的网站.我希望表单向我显示上传项目的外观预览.所以我使用 ng-model 来实现这一点,我偶然发现了以下内容: 我有一个包含一些基本引导程序样式的输入,并且我正在为 AngularJS 模板使用自定义括号(因为正如我所提到的,我正在使用 Laravel 及其刀片系统).我需要从输
..
在这个例子中,我在 ng-repeat,但是如何在变量和 ng-if 中使用它,例如: {{languages.length |过滤器:{可用:真实}}} 和 ng-if="languages.length == 0 | filter: {available: true}" 请参阅小提琴. HTML
总共有 {{languages.length}} 种语言.
..
给定一个测试过滤器,比如这个 'capitalize' 过滤器这将使每个单词的第一个字母大写: 返回函数(输入){返回(!!输入)?input.replace(/([^\W_]+[^\s-]*) */g, 函数 (txt) {返回 txt.charAt(0).toUpperCase() + txt.substr(1).toLowerCase();}) : '';} 如何从浏览器的 JavaSc
..
我不想使用 ng-repeat 来显示按对象值过滤的列表.这是我的尝试 https://plnkr.co/edit/vD4UfzM4Qg7c0WGTeY18?p=preview 以下内容按预期返回了我的所有 JSON names. {{navitem.name}}
现在我想过滤并只显示具有 "for
..
我正在前端使用 AngularJS 编写应用程序.我想通过任何单词/字段搜索表格;一个搜索框搜索所有内容.我试图遵循这个 plunker 的工作示例:http://plnkr.co/edit/aIuSDYlFbC4doW6pfsC9?p=预览 这是我在前端的代码: 搜索:
..
Lastname名字
..
我正在尝试实现一个基于给定值绘制图表的指令.我希望从模板中传递绘图的数据.我有一个可行的解决方案,在 ng-model 中传递数据,然后我可以添加一个 $scope.watch 语句.但这不适用于过滤后的数据,而且我不需要双向绑定. 理想情况下,html 应如下所示: 我想指令应该是这样的: 返回{限制:'C',链接:功能(范围,元素,属性){var 图表 = 空scope.$w
..
标签的末尾包含你的 JS 文件,并确保你的顺序正确.即在 angular-simple-logger.js 之前包含 angular.js $scope 的使用:可以直接使用 scope,不需要扩展,只会增加阅读难度. 模型结构:您的 Markers 元素太深了,我将 Markers 变量设为标记对象数组. 解决方案 使用Angular的filter,挺好的,但是需要正确
..
我想做什么: 我在要过滤的关联数组上使用 ng-repeat 指令.内置角度过滤器不适用于关联数组/哈希.因此,我正在尝试编写自己的过滤器(灵感来自 http://angularjs.de/artikel/angularjs-ng-repeat;它是德语,但重要的代码在标题“Beispiel 2:Filtern von Hashes mittels eigenem Filter"下面,意思是
..
我有两个集合 user 和 Type.我希望显示标记为 IsPreffered = TRUE 的电子邮件 ID,我需要将 email.Type 映射到 Type.ID { "用户" : [{"Name" : "B. Balamanigandan",“电子邮件": [{"id": "bala@gmail.com",“IsPrefered":真,“类型":1,},{"id": "mani@gmail
..
在我的控制器中,我可以调用: $scope.games[0]; 访问我的游戏数组中的第一项.有没有办法做到这一点,同时记住过滤器. 例如我有: 过滤器:搜索 再说一遍,我如何调用 $scope.list[0];等于第一个搜索结果? 已经回答了,谢谢.我使用 AngluarJs 为 Lagged.com 构建了一个很酷的小部件,在这里玩免费的在线游戏:https://lagged
..
我不想使用 ng-repeat 来显示按对象值过滤的列表.这是我的尝试 https://plnkr.co/edit/vD4UfzM4Qg7c0WGTeY18?p=preview 以下内容按预期返回了我的所有 JSON names. {{navitem.name}}
现在我想过滤并只显示具有 "for
..
ng_repeat 的 AngularJS 过滤器在搜索文本“!"时不起作用.就像搜索文本是“!图标".然后它返回不包含“图标"的结果.我也试过 angularjs.org. https://docs.angularjs.org/api/ng/directive/ngRepeat 当我搜索“28"时,它只填充两个结果,但是当我搜索“!28"时,它返回 8 个不包含 28 的结果.
..